Here is the query

from a in this._addresses
where a.Street.Contains(street) || a.StreetAdditional.Contains(streetAdditional)
select a).ToList<Address>()

if both properties in the where clause have values this works fine, but if for example, a.StreetAdditional is null (Most of the times), I will get a null reference exception.

Is there a work around this?

I'd use the null-coalescing operator...

(from a in this._addresses
where (a.Street ?? "").Contains(street) || (a.StreetAdditional ?? "").Contains(streetAdditional)
select a).ToList<Address>()
